Construction of wastewater treatment plant and collectors in Chirpan
The city of Chirpan falls within the group of agglomerations with more than 10 000 population equivalents and as such is defined as a priority for funding agglomeration under Priority Axis 1 of Operational Programme “Environment” 2014-2020. According to NSI data, the permanent population of Chirpan as of 31.12.2016 is 14 424 people, who are the main target group of the project, together with the active companies and visitors of the city. Co-funding: the EU contributes €4.0M toward a total project cost of €5.4M — a co-funding rate of 74%, with the remainder covered by national, regional or private sources.
